Director, Total Rewards
Job Description
Responsibilities
- Total Rewards Strategy:
- -Develop, implement, and maintain a total rewards strategy aligned with the company's business goals, values, and culture.
- Innovate and react quickly as business and market realities change, staying up to date on best practices and trends; ensure compliance with applicable legislation.
- Compensation Management:
- Oversee the design, execution, and management of the company's compensation programs, including base salary, bonuses, long-term incentives, and executive compensation.
- Lead the team through regular benchmarking cycles to analyze and assess market data, industry trends, and best practices to create market competitive reward packages.
- Implement and maintain performance-based pay strategies that reward high performance and drive employee engagement.
- Ensure equity and fairness in compensation practices while maintaining compliance with relevant regulations.
- Develop and implement additional pay policies and practices in line with the needs of a global and complex business.
- Collaborate with People and leadership teams to align performance management processes with compensation practices.
- Benefits Administration:
- Bring innovative practices and designs to our employee benefits programs through the lens of supporting all generational and life stage needs – including health and wellness benefits, retirement plans, and other benefit programs.
- Collaborate with benefits vendors to optimize offerings, control costs, and enhance employee satisfaction.
- Compliance and Governance:
- Stay informed about relevant labor laws, regulations, and industry standards, ensuring all compensation and benefits programs comply with legal requirements.
- Work closely with legal and compliance teams to address any issues or concerns.
- Data Analysis and Reporting:
- Drive analytical rigor and deep analysis on effectiveness and competitiveness of existing programs; establish key metrics including usage, engagement, and cost analyses.
- Leverage analytical, communication and presentation skills to provide insights to senior leadership on the impact of total rewards on talent attraction, retention, and engagement.
- Budgeting and Cost Management:
- Develop and manage the total rewards budget, ensuring cost-effective solutions that align with the company's financial objectives.
- Communication and Education:
- Develop and execute communication strategies to educate employees about compensation and benefits programs.
- Provide guidance and support to people team and management in addressing employee inquiries related to total rewards.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Business, Human Resources, or a related field required.
- Minimum of 10+ years of human resources experience with a focus and core competency in compensation
- Strong business acumen with a focus on life sciences.
- Demonstrated ability to effectively develop and lead comprehensive total rewards programs that drive talent attraction
- High level of emotional intelligence, natural leadership aptitude, and strong partnership skills
- Demonstrated skill in building relationships at the senior level, influencing, and driving to consensus
- Strong project management and prioritization skills, with the ability to pivot quickly
- Deep data-orientation and desire to fuel business decisions by providing insights
- Expert in HR systems and MS office tools with a focus on Excel and PowerPoint
- Deep knowledge of HR compliance, employment law, and regulatory requirements
